Mounting Type
Mounting Type refers to the method by which an electronic component is attached to a printed circuit board (PCB) or other surface. Common mounting types include:
* Through-hole: Component leads are inserted into holes in the PCB and soldered on the other side.
* Surface-mount: Component is placed on the surface of the PCB and soldered in place.
* Press-fit: Component is pressed into place on the PCB without soldering.
* Socket: Component is inserted into a socket on the PCB, allowing for easy replacement.
The mounting type is determined by factors such as the component's size, shape, and power requirements.

Package / Case
Package / Case refers to the physical housing or enclosure that encapsulates an electronic component. It provides protection, facilitates handling, and enables electrical connections. The package type determines the component's size, shape, pin configuration, and mounting options. Common package types include DIP (dual in-line package), SOIC (small outline integrated circuit), and BGA (ball grid array). The package also influences the component's thermal and electrical performance.

Moisture Sensitivity Level (MSL)
Moisture Sensitivity Level (MSL) is a measure of the susceptibility of a surface mount electronic component to moisture-induced damage during soldering. It is classified into six levels, from 1 (least sensitive) to 6 (most sensitive). MSL is determined by the materials used in the component's construction, including the solderability of its terminals and the presence of moisture-absorbing materials. Components with higher MSL ratings require more stringent handling and storage conditions to prevent moisture absorption and subsequent damage during soldering.

Temperature Coefficient
Temperature Coefficient (TC) measures the relative change in a component's value due to temperature variations. It is expressed as a percentage change per degree Celsius (°C). A positive TC indicates an increase in value with increasing temperature, while a negative TC indicates a decrease. TC is crucial for ensuring stable circuit performance over a range of temperatures. It helps designers compensate for temperature-induced changes and maintain desired component characteristics.

Description
The ZRC500 is a precision micropower voltage reference that uses a bandgap circuit design to achieve a stable 5.0-volt output. It is available in small outline surface mount and through-hole packages. The ZRC500 does not require an external capacitor for stabilization and is stable with capacitive loads. It is recommended for operation between 25μA and 5mA, making it suitable for low power and battery-powered applications. The rugged design and 20-volt processing allow the reference to withstand transient effects and currents up to 200mA.
Features
Small outline SOT23 packages
No stabilizing capacitor required
Low knee current, 19μA typical
Typical Tc 30ppm/°C
Typical slope resistance 0.402
±2% and ±1% tolerance
Industrial temperature range
Operating current 25μA to 5mA
Transient response, stable in less than 10us
Green molding compound (No Br. Sb)
Applications
Battery powered and portable equipment
Instrumentation
Test equipment
Metering and measurement systems
